Band 8+: Some people think that renewable energy sources should replace traditional fossil fuels. Discuss the advantages and disadvantages of this approach.

The increasing demand for energy has sparked debates about whether renewable energy sources should fully replace traditional fossil fuels. While renewable energy offers sustainability and environmental benefits, transitioning entirely away from fossil fuels presents economic and technical challenges. This essay will explore the advantages and disadvantages of replacing fossil fuels with renewable energy sources.

One of the most significant benefits of renewable energy is its sustainability. Unlike fossil fuels, which are finite and depleting, renewable sources such as solar, wind, and hydroelectric power are naturally replenished. This ensures long-term energy security and reduces dependency on non-renewable resources. Another major advantage is the environmental benefit. Fossil fuels contribute to air pollution, global warming, and climate change by emitting carbon dioxide and other greenhouse gases. Renewable energy sources, on the other hand, produce little to no emissions, helping to mitigate environmental degradation and promote a cleaner planet. Furthermore, the renewable energy sector can drive economic growth and job creation. As countries invest in green technologies, industries related to solar panel production, wind turbine manufacturing, and energy storage solutions expand. This can create millions of new jobs and stimulate economic development, particularly in developing nations.

Despite these benefits, there are significant challenges to completely transitioning to renewable energy. One of the primary drawbacks is reliability. Renewable energy sources depend on natural conditions; for example, solar panels require sunlight, and wind turbines need consistent wind flow. This intermittency makes it difficult to ensure a stable and continuous power supply without advanced energy storage systems, which are still expensive and underdeveloped. Another challenge is the high initial cost of infrastructure. Switching from fossil fuels to renewable energy requires significant investment in new power plants, transmission networks, and storage facilities. Many developing countries may struggle to afford such large-scale transformations, making fossil fuels a more accessible and cost-effective option in the short term.

While replacing fossil fuels with renewable energy offers clear environmental and economic benefits, several challenges must be addressed, including energy reliability, high costs, and ecological concerns. A gradual transition, supported by technological advancements and policy incentives, may be the most practical solution. A balanced approach that incorporates both renewable and cleaner fossil fuel technologies, such as carbon capture, could ensure a stable and sustainable energy future.
